A fireman is firing at a distant target and has only 10% chance of hitting it. the number of rounds, he must fire in order to have 50% chance of hitting it at least once is

let he fire n number of times.
so he will miss (n-1) times and at nth time he will hit
total probability
= 1/10 + 9/10 *1/10 + 9/10 *9/10 *1/10 + .....(9/10) n-1 *1/10 = 50/100
=1/10[ 1+ (9/10) + (9/10) 2 + ............(9/10) n-1 ] =5/10
or [1- (9/10) n ]/(1-9/10) =5
0r 1-(9/10) n =1/2 (9/10) n =1/2 nlog9/10 = log1/2
n = log.5 / log.9 =6.58
so he must hit at least 7 times
